Top Attractions & Must-Visit Places in Laweyan, Indonesia
Laweyan's got a lot to offer! Here are a few spots you won't want to miss:
- The Laweyan Batik Village: This is the heart and soul of Laweyan. Wander through the workshops, watch artisans create stunning batik fabrics, and maybe even try your hand at it yourself. It's a truly immersive cultural experience.
- Masjid Laweyan: This historic mosque is a beautiful example of Javanese architecture. Take some time to appreciate its intricate details and peaceful atmosphere.
- Local Markets: Get lost in the vibrant atmosphere of Laweyan's bustling markets. You'll find everything from fresh produce to traditional crafts – a great place to pick up some unique souvenirs.

When’s the Best Time to Go?
Indonesia has a tropical climate. The dry season (May to September) is generally the best time to visit, with pleasant weather and less rain. However, Laweyan is charming year-round.
